As New York City continues to push toward a low-carbon future, thermal energy networks offer an opportunity to optimize energy efficiency and reduce greenhouse gas emissions. TENS.NYC plays a central role in driving this transition by facilitating partnerships and providing a space for knowledge sharing and strategic collaboration. From developing cutting-edge district heating and cooling systems to addressing complex regulatory and financial challenges, we support the deployment of thermal energy solutions that meet the city's unique needs. Thermal energy networks are at the heart of the clean energy transition, enabling efficient heating, cooling, and energy sharing across entire communities.
